Minecraft is getting an automated system for sorting storage rooms. Copper Golems are bustling around and are really useful.

Minecraft has become larger and more complex over the years. From a handful of different blocks, there are now hundreds of different ones – and there are many more materials, whether in their original form or processed. Keeping track of everything and sorting all the possessions can be exhausting.

But Minecraft has announced a solution: Soon there will be Copper Golems that will bustle around your base and sort your chests!

How do you create a Copper Golem? Creating a Copper Golem is quite simple. You only need a block of copper and a pumpkin lantern. Once you place the pumpkin lantern on the copper block, the little Copper Golem will appear – along with a first copper chest that also teaches you the recipe to build more.

Copper Golem replaces hours of inventory management

How does the Copper Golem work? As of now, the Copper Golem searches a radius of 36 blocks around its location for copper chests. If it discovers a copper chest, it will head to it and take all items from there (a maximum of 16 stacks). Then the Copper Golem looks for regular chests and automatically sorts these items into them.

It only puts items in chests that are either completely empty or already contain items of the same type. So, for example, it would never put wood in a chest that has only stones in it.

Or to put it simply: The Copper Golem sorts all items from copper chests into your regular chests.

The days of having to distribute your entire inventory into dozens of chests for several minutes are over!

While there were already ways to build an automated sorting system, it required a good understanding of redstone – and at the same time, you had to use up a lot of space to connect the sorting system to a warehouse.

When will the Copper Golem be released? There is no specific release date for the Copper Golem yet, but the next major patch is scheduled for autumn 2025 – until then, you can at least try out the Copper Golem in the test version.
